NULL TypeMapping

I'm getting an error when I try to use Java2WSDL.  It is a
java.lang.NullPointerException within org.apache.axis.fromJava.Types when
trying to generate a schema.  it seems that that Types object was
instantiated with a NULL for it's internal TypeMapping (TypeMapping tm)
When the serializer tries to write the schema a call is made to
isSimpleType(Class type), for a java.lang.String class, but when trying to
get the QName for the Class/type the TypeMapping reference is Null.




Does anyone know why the TypeMapping would be set to Null?  Should a check
be made if tm is null to use the defaultTM TypeMapping instead?
